City Experiences in Nice

Day 1: Saturday, August 26, 2023

Morning: Explore Old Town

Start your day by exploring the charming Old Town of Nice, known as Vieux Nice. Stroll through its narrow, winding streets filled with colorful buildings, small shops, and local cafes. Admire the beautiful architecture of the Cathédrale Sainte-Réparate and visit the lively Cours Saleya market, where you can find fresh produce, flowers, and local specialties. Take a leisurely walk along the Promenade des Anglais, a famous promenade that stretches along the coast, offering stunning views of the Mediterranean Sea.

  • Old Town: Free, Approx. 2-3 hours
  • Cathédrale Sainte-Réparate: Free, Approx. 30 minutes
  • Cours Saleya market: Free, Approx. 1 hour
  • Promenade des Anglais: Free, Approx. 1-2 hours
Afternoon: Visit Musée Matisse and Colline du Château

Spend your afternoon exploring the artistic side of Nice. Visit the Musée Matisse, a museum dedicated to the works of renowned artist Henri Matisse. Admire his masterpieces and learn about his life and artistic journey. Afterward, head to Colline du Château, a hilltop park offering panoramic views of Nice and its surroundings. Enjoy a picnic or simply relax in the peaceful atmosphere while taking in the breathtaking vistas.

  • Musée Matisse: €10 (estimated), Approx. 1-2 hours
  • Colline du Château: Free, Approx. 1-2 hours
Evening: Promenade du Paillon and Place Masséna

In the evening, take a stroll along the Promenade du Paillon, a lovely park with lush greenery, fountains, and interactive artwork. Enjoy the vibrant atmosphere as locals gather for picnics or outdoor activities. Continue to Place Masséna, the main square of Nice, illuminated by colorful lights after sunset. Admire the impressive architecture, fountain displays, and browse the nearby shops and restaurants.

  • Promenade du Paillon: Free, Approx. 1-2 hours
  • Place Masséna: Free, Approx. 1-2 hours

Day 2: Sunday, August 27, 2023

Morning: Explore Musée d'Art Moderne et d'Art Contemporain

Start your second day in Nice by visiting the Musée d'Art Moderne et d'Art Contemporain (MAMAC). Discover a diverse collection of modern and contemporary art, including works by renowned artists such as Andy Warhol and Yves Klein. Immerse yourself in the vibrant art scene and gain a deeper understanding of modern artistic expressions.

  • Musée d'Art Moderne et d'Art Contemporain: €10 (estimated), Approx. 2-3 hours
Afternoon: Relax at Promenade des Anglais and Le Negresco

In the afternoon, head back to the Promenade des Anglais for some relaxation under the sun. Find a spot on the beach and soak up the Mediterranean atmosphere. If you're interested in art and history, visit Le Negresco, a famous luxury hotel known for its opulent Belle Époque design. Admire the exquisite interiors and take a walk along the elegant corridors filled with art and antiques.

  • Promenade des Anglais: Free, Approx. 2-3 hours
  • Le Negresco: Free (to visit), Approx. 1 hour
Evening: Enjoy Nice's Nightlife

As the evening sets in, experience the vibrant nightlife of Nice. Head to the lively Rue de la Préfecture, a popular street known for its bars, clubs, and live music venues. Enjoy a delicious dinner at one of the local restaurants, savoring the flavors of the region. Immerse yourself in the energetic atmosphere and dance the night away in one of the city's vibrant clubs.

  • Rue de la Préfecture: Cost varies, Approx. 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, consider visiting the Musée National Marc Chagall, dedicated to the works of the renowned Russian-French painter. Explore the peaceful gardens and admire Chagall's mesmerizing masterpieces. Another hidden gem is the Parc Phoenix, a botanical garden and zoo where you can discover a wide variety of plant species, as well as animals from around the world. Locals also love to escape the city buzz by taking a short trip to the nearby village of Eze, perched high on a hill with stunning views and charming medieval streets.
